Parkgate Road is in Orpington and in Sevenoaks district. BR6 7PY is located in the Crockenhill and Well Hill elect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Sevenoaks.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ding BR6 7PY,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 52.2%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Safety

Is Parkgate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Parkgate Road was 86.7 per 1,000 residents, which is 31.8% higher than the Crockenhill and Well Hill average. The most reported crime type was Vehicle crime.

Parkgate Road has the 5th highest crime rate of 22 local areas in Crockenhill and Well Hill and the 83rd highest crime rate of 361 local areas in Sevenoaks .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 25.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-72.2%.

Employment

BR6 7PY area has a very high level of entrepreneurship. Only 6%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 16%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.
